When I finally get on stable financial ground again I’m thinking of trying Guild Wars next, mostly because there is no monthly membership.

That’s the rough part of playing these games; they’re fun and incredibly addicting, but justifying forking over the standard $15 monthly membership fee after you’ve already paid $50 just to play the game can be difficult. Sure they give you 30 days free when you buy it, but that’s just enough to make you feel guilty that you’ve wasted time if you don’t continue to pay after investing all those hours of gameplay.

The most I’ve stuck with MMO games is about six months before I get tired of the high-level grind. This is the stage of the game where you so close to the maximum progress you can make with your character as far as getting new powers or skills. When you get close to this point, it takes a long, long time to get to the next “level” which changes from game to game. Some like City of Heroes/Villains and World of Warcraft go to 50, while Guild Wars and D&D: Stormreach only to 20. When I get to that point, my interest starts to wander in the game because I’m no longer enjoying it. It’s almost become a job and that’s not exactly what i’m looking for in a video game.
